
Our mission, vision and values
AHPN's mission is to improve the health and wellbeing of African descent communities living in the UK who are disproportionately affected by long term health conditions such as HIV, mental health, diabetes and obesity.
Our vision is to narrow the health inequality gap by ensuring that Black communities in the UK have equal access to services, support and information. This is achieved through a human rights-based approach that ensures that the design, delivery and monitoring of health and cares services are tailored around the needs of Black people in the UK.
Our values commit AHPN to being a leading independent voice for achieving the human rights of Black communities in the UK, through:
Inclusivity and involvement
Education and empowerment
Partnership and collaboration
Community focus and a global perspective.
